How do I Void a transaction?


What is a Void?


A VOID nullifies information regarding the authorisation (such as the bank code) on a particular transaction to ensure that it does not send any values/information for settlement. However, the information is only removed from the Protx system and may still remain active on the acquiring bank's system.


Even though an online reversal is sent when a VOID is performed, this does not guarantee that the shadow will be removed.


Once a Void has been performed, there is no way of reversing this and you will need to take another transaction in order to obtain the funds from the shopper.


image - Section Divider


How is a Void performed?


If the transaction HAS NOT yet been sent for settlement, you will be able to VOID the transaction. This will cancel the transaction and not include it within the daily bank settlement file.


As the transaction HAS NOT been sent for settlement, your acquiring bank has not received any information about the payment and therefore the payment will not appear on the shopper's card statement.


A VOID can only be performed on a REAL-TIME PAYMENT or a REFUNDED transaction and is the responsibility of the Vendor to perform.


image - Section Divider


How is a Void performed via my VSP Admin area?


A VOID can be performed via the VSP Admin area for any transaction that has not yet been sent for settlement. Please be advised that once a transaction has been settled, you can no longer VOID it. The cut off point is midnight every night, after which the settlement files are forwarded to the respective acquiring banks. If the transaction has already been forwarded for settlement, you will need to Refund the payment.


Before logging in to your Protx VSP Admin account, you need to ensure that you have granted the Void privilege to the 'User' that you intend to log in as to perform the Void.


Once logged in, you will need to find the transaction you wish to Void.


You can search for the transaction by using either of the search tools, 'The Daily transaction List' or the 'Find a Transaction', both from under 'Transactions' in the menu.


If you use the 'Daily Transaction List' as the search, then obviously you will need to have a fair idea of the date of the transaction and the name of the cardholder (customer). The results of the search would then be displayed as shown below:



image - screenshot of VSP Admin daily transaction list

Click on the actual 'VendorTxCode' of the payment that needs voiding. If you wanted to Void Test User 1's £1.00 transaction (as per the screenshot above), then you would click on 'VSPT-protx-test002'


The full transaction detail will now be displayed in a new browser window - if you scroll to the bottom of the page you should see a section of further options called 'Actions' (see screenshot below)


image - screenshot of VSP Admin refund details

Click on the Void button image - VSP Admin Void button


If the Void button is not displayed, it could mean one of two things:


  • You have not granted the User account with the Void privilege.

  • The transaction has already been forwarded for settlement and therefore cannot be Voided.

Once the Void button has been clicked you will be presented with a Void confirmation screen (screenshot shown below) - you will need to enter a Password in order to process the Void. This Password is that of the 'User' you are currently logged in as while performing the Void.


Now just click the 'Void' button again image - VSP Admin Void button


The Void request will now be processed and confirmed on screen.



image - screenshot of VSP Admin void administration



Once the Void has been processed it will appear under the 'Failed Transactions' section.


The screenshot below shows the Void performed above in the 'Failed Transactions' section of the VSP Admin account.



image - screenshot of VSP Admin failed or cancelled transaction list